Solutions and conservation laws of some systems of fractional nonlinear partial differential equations with the help of lie symmetry method

Özet (EN)

Recently, most complex problems in science and engineering have been formulated by nonlinear partial differential equations. Therefore, it has become more important to obtain analytical solutions for analysing the behavioral properties of these equations. The Lie symmetry analysis method, which was introduced by Sophus Lie at the beginning of the 19th century and later named after him, brought a new perspective to the solution of nonlinear partial differential equations. The main purpose of this method is to construct similarity transformations that leave the differential equations invariant form. These similarity transformations reduce a partial differential equation into a ordinary differential equation of fractional order and make it easy to obtain exact solutions. Also, using the connection between Lie symmetries and Noether operators, conservation laws of differential equations can be obtained. In this thesis, the Lie symmetry method is applied to the nonlinear time fractional generalized Drienfeld Sokolov and Super KdV systems in order to acquire similarity transformations for systems with the help of the Riemann-Liouville fractional derivative. These two systems are reduced into fractional ordinary differential equation systems using the similarity transformations. Then, the conserved vectors of the systems are obtained by using the conservation laws that Ibragimov put forward by using the connection between the Lie symmetries and Noether operators. Finally, we obtain explicit power series solutions of the reduced fractional ordinary differential equations and show that these solutions are convergence.
